FAQ: What if an incremental rebuild on Cobbleworth leaves stale pages in production?

First, confirm the build manifest diverged by comparing it against the content snapshot. If it has, do not rerun the build; instead, invoke the rollback utility, which restores the last verified manifest. The utility requires the release vault recovery passphrase, provided immediately below.

vault phrase of tajef-tafog = istox-sorax-zorox-casok-holox-kelix-weneth-drueth-casion

14:22 — The Bucketeer assignment service at Vexlan Labs began returning stale cohort maps after the config cache missed its refresh window. Roughly 9% of users in the Larkspur experiment were double-assigned for eleven minutes. Mira rolled back the cache TTL change and assignments stabilized. The offending deploy is identified by the token below.

trace token, kahog-tajeg: htk6_97d963

# Divestiture: Orvell Analytics Unit (Managers Only)

Quick update for the finance crew. The sale of Orvell Analytics to Pellworth Group is moving faster than expected — signing is penciled in for the 14th. Karla Denem is coordinating the working-capital adjustments, so route any questions on deferred revenue her way. Heads up: payroll carve-out gets messy around the Tarnholt office, so flag anything odd early. Don't mention the deal outside this page, even internally. The strategic reasoning behind the timing is summarized just below.

management briefing: The renewal with Zoraelax Group closes at $10 million a year, 15 percent below the last contract. Project Ralael slips by six weeks because of the audit delay.